Frequently asked

About NEW TOWN MIDDLE SCHOOL
How large is NEW TOWN MIDDLE SCHOOL?
NEW TOWN MIDDLE SCHOOL enrolls approximately 158 students in grades 07-08.
What grades does NEW TOWN MIDDLE SCHOOL serve?
NEW TOWN MIDDLE SCHOOL serves grades 07-08.
What is the student-teacher ratio at NEW TOWN MIDDLE SCHOOL?
The student-to-teacher ratio at NEW TOWN MIDDLE SCHOOL is approximately 8.6:1 (18 FTE teachers).
What is the racial breakdown of students at NEW TOWN MIDDLE SCHOOL?
At NEW TOWN MIDDLE SCHOOL, the student body is approximately 3% White, 6% Hispanic, 1% Black, 3% Asian, 1% Two or more.
Who oversees NEW TOWN MIDDLE SCHOOL?
NEW TOWN MIDDLE SCHOOL is overseen by NEW TOWN 1 in Mountrail County.
